Safety Evaluation of Four New Pesticides in Aquatic Ecosystem

Abstract: Acute toxicity tests of four new pesticides were conducted in the lab with Scenedesmus obliquus,Daphnia magna and Brachydanio rerio as subject to evaluate the safety of pesticides in the aquatic ecosystem.Results showed that acetamiprid as pesticide was extremely toxic to Daphnia magna,highly toxic to Brachydanio rerio and low toxic to Scenedesmus obliquus;pymetrozine as pesticide was low toxic to Daphnia magna and Brachydanio rerio,but moderately toxic to Scenedesmus obliquus;oxadiazon as herbicide is highly toxic to Scenedesmus obliquus,but moderately toxic to Daphnia magna and Brachydanio rerio;quizalofop-p-ethyl as herbicide was highly toxic to Scenedesmus obliquus and Brachydanio rerio,but moderately toxic to Daphnia magna.
